India receives its first GE locomotive under $2.5 bn deal

India has received first of the 1,000 high power diesel electric railway locomotives that are to be supplied by General Electric’s (GE), American industrial giant as a part of $2.5 billion agreement .

The agreement was signed in 2015 with an aim to modernize country’s ageing loco fleet.

The company stated,”GE Transportation today took another important step forward in its partnership with Indian Railways when the first of 1,000 diesel electric Evolution series locomotives arrived at India’s Mundra Port.”
